RTX 2070 Max-Q — NVIDIA laptop graphics card (2018, Turing) with 8 GB of GDDR6, averaging 17 fps at 1440p.

RX M 5600 XT — AMD desktop graphics card (2020, RDNA 1) with 6 GB of GDDR6, averaging 21 fps at 1440p.

RTX 2070 Max-Q vs RX M 5600 XT: RX M 5600 XT is faster for gaming. RX M 5600 XT averages 21 fps at 1440p versus 17 fps — about 19% faster. RTX 2070 Max-Q draws less power (78W vs 97W).

1080p, 1440p and 4K

At 1440p — the most common enthusiast resolution — the RX M 5600 XT averages 21 fps against 17. At 4K (9 vs 11 fps) VRAM (8GB vs 6GB) and memory bandwidth matter more.

Power and value

Board power is 78 W versus 97 W, which affects PSU headroom, case cooling and noise.

Methodology

Graphics cards are compared on 3DMark Time Spy scores, average gaming frame rates at 1080p/1440p/4K, FP32 compute throughput, VRAM capacity and type, memory bandwidth, board power (TDP) and launch MSRP — plus AI workload throughput (Stable Diffusion iterations/s and local LLM tokens/s) where measured. Vintage and server GPUs without modern benchmark results are compared on specifications only, clearly labelled. Frame rates are averages across a game suite at high settings; specific titles vary.
